25.09.2015 Views

Hardware/Software Introduction Chapter 1 Introduction

Embedded Systems Design: A Unified Hardware/Software ... - EET

Embedded Systems Design: A Unified Hardware/Software ... - EET

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

New challenges to processor users<br />

• Licensing arrangements<br />

– Not as easy as purchasing IC<br />

– More contracts enforcing pricing model and IP protection<br />

• Possibly requiring legal assistance<br />

• Extra design effort<br />

– Especially for soft cores<br />

• Must still be synthesized and tested<br />

• Minor differences in synthesis tools can cause problems<br />

• Verification requirements more difficult<br />

– Extensive testing for synthesized soft cores and soft/firm cores mapped to particular<br />

technology<br />

• Ensure correct synthesis<br />

• Timing and power vary between implementations<br />

– Early verification critical<br />

• Cores buried within IC<br />

• Cannot simply replace bad core<br />

Embedded Systems Design: A Unified<br />

<strong>Hardware</strong>/<strong>Software</strong> <strong>Introduction</strong>, (c) 2000 Vahid/Givargis<br />

87

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!